The Neighborhood:
Cannonborough Elliotborough is a striking, hip neighborhood, dotted with indie stores, vintage stores, trendy eateries & bakeries. Residents, students, & visitors savor a walkable lifestyle, just a few blocks from bustling Upper King Street.

Getting Around:
Located in the heart of the Cannonborough and Elliotborough neighborhood, upper King St. and the Charleston peninsula are at your doorstep. Rated a 97/100 walkability score and 75/100 bicycle-ability score (with a Lime bicycle hub just a few blocks away) discover Charleston with ease from any of our units in The Palm Club Collection.

Too hot or too far to walk? Not a problem, Charleston offers a variety of transportation options such as the DASH a complimentary downtown shuttle, a unique pedicab experience offered year-round, or any of your favorite ride share companies operating in and around town.

Catering to the millions of visitors Charleston hosts each year there are ample private and shared services geared to easing guests’ ability to get from the airport to downtown. Whether a shuttle, private car service, or bag valet guests can make their way to their Palm Club Collection unit anxiety complimentary. How to find the best Charleston rental experience:

Sticking to your rental home budget:

  • June, July, and August are the most expensive months in coastal SC. Reserve your vacation home in the Fall or Spring shoulder seasons to get the benefit of warm we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ities. Many vacationers use this method to find larger homes within budget, or to book an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unavailable or unaffordable during the Summer.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Charleston area v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day near the ocean?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years are great times to gather with loved ones at your favorite beach.
  • The earlier you can book a rental home, the easier your search will be. The best properties are reserved very early. Reserving your vacation home 6-12 months before your travel dates is recommended. Holiday gatherings are excellent times to plan and book your vacation home.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property owner whether your vacationing group qualifies for a special promotion or discount.
  • Booking websites frequently offer their guests an option to buy tr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which normally will cost 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for missed vacation time as a result of personal medical-related catastrophes or weather, as well as ev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ance can be a a life-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ask the property owner for more information.
  • Often, rental management companies supply Charleston area area visitors guide magazines which include money-saving offers, either offered independently by local companies, or through a partnership between the property management company and the business itself. You can also find visitors guide and coupon books at local gas stations and shopping centers.

Some things to know before you go:

  • Review check in & check out procedures before traveling. Take a printed copy, and save the instructions to your smartphone.
  • Document any damages to the rental during check in, and immediately send them to the host. We specifically rec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ain time stamps that can be very helpful if damages are assessed.
  • Hosts are available to help! Don't be shy to ask questions before, during, or after your stay.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like troublesome vacationers disrupting your quiet neighborhood. Practice the golden rule for best judgement. Happy residents may even recommend great restaurants and scenic spots you would have not otherwise known about!
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Residents can typically help. Who better to ask where to go for the best drinks,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Lock your vacation home while you're out and about. Keep your property safe!
  • Don't leave anything behind! Just before departing, walk through the rental property to reconfirm you've collected everything. Remember to check bathrooms, dressers, and closets for hidden treasure.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Document the condition of the property at check-out. We recommend taking a video during your final walk-through.
